Learning Outcomes

Students will learn to apply the essential ideas of empowering thinking to their action. They will analyse the challenges of the empowering work approach in preventive and curative work with the elderly. Students will learn to promote the wellbeing, visibility and social engagement of older people both in mainstream and minority cultures, and to enhance interaction between cultures.

Contents

Theoretical basis of empowerment; individual awareness; empowering work in elderly care; minority cultures in elderly care in Finland
